Input的size与maxlength属性的区别自我理解
最近我在项目中涉及到了HTML的input元素的size和maxlength属性。过去,我仅仅是使用它们,却未曾深入了解它们的差异。今天,我决定利用周末的时间,通过baidu一下,终于有了一些新的领悟,特此记录。
在HTML中,我们经常会遇到这样的代码片段:
Name:
这行代码中的maxlength属性指定了输入框中能够输入的最大字符数。在这个例子中,用户只能输入5个字符。如果尝试输入更多,浏览器会提示输入过长并限制输入。
而另一段代码:
Name2:
这里用到的size属性并不是限制输入的长度,而是规定了输入字段的可视宽度。换句话说,size="5"意味着输入框只显示5个字符的宽度,但用户实际上可以输入更多的字符。这个属性更多的是关于界面显示,给了我们一个直观的视觉提示。
为了保证网页的响应式和流式布局,现代Web开发更倾向于使用CSS来进行布局和样式设计。如果我们想要设置输入框的宽度,更推荐的方式是使用CSS中的width属性。例如:
这样设置不仅可以改变输入框的显示宽度,还能确保其适应各种屏幕和设备。
size和maxlength虽然都是关于输入框的属性,但它们的职能截然不同。正确理解并合理使用这些属性,可以帮助我们创建更加友好、高效的Web应用。今天的学习让我对这些细节有了更深的理解,期待将这些知识应用到未来的项目中。
值得一提的是,我们应避免在文本中出现与主题无关的内容,例如电话、、和手机号码等。这样可以确保文章的专注性和连贯性,让读者更加聚焦于我们所讨论的主题。
seo推广
- Input的size与maxlength属性的区别自我理解
- 3dmax文件保存后超大该怎缩小-
- 开机有桌面背景但无法进入系统的解决方法
- 引入Dash闪充技术 一加云耳蓝牙耳机充电10分钟可
- 给初学者的第二封信 学会自由画面控制明暗技巧
- 了解世界各地天气情况 Macbook设置电脑天气小工具
- ai怎么设计流星效果的英文字母字体- ai英文字体
- msvcmm32.exe - msvcmm32是什么进程 有什么用
- 电脑丢失msvcp100.dll怎么办?解决msvcp100.dll丢失的
- win10系统怎么设置开机加速?
- css3 iphone玻璃透明气泡完美实现
- CAD硬件加速栅格鼠标很卡顿该怎么办?
- form 在上传文件时用enctype字段有什么用处
- CorelDRAW10新增的shape工具详解介绍
- Win10如何硬盘分区 Win10硬盘分区的方法
- surface studio怎么升级配置 surface studio配置升级视频